Information Technology Certificate Programs

Our IT certificate programs provide specialized training across a range of in-demand fields, including cybersecurity, data science, Python programming, web development (both front-end and back-end), software testing, machine learning, and digital marketing. These short-term, hands-on programs focus on practical skills that align with industry standards, making them perfect for individuals looking to enhance their technical expertise, transition to a new career, or gain a competitive edge. With options for both beginners and professionals, our courses also cover areas like API test automation, UI/UX design, and digital literacy, preparing you for a wide variety of roles in the ever-evolving IT sector.

Certificate Programs

Certificate Program in

Cyber Security

The Certificate Program in Cyber Security is designed to provide foundational knowledge and skills in cybersecurity for beginners. This comprehensive 12-module course introduces learners to essential cybersecurity concepts, principles and practices needed to protect personal and organizational data in today’s digital world. Participants will explore fundamental topics, including cybersecurity threats, security principles, authentication, cryptography, network security and common cyber attacks.

Certificate Program in

Data Science

The Certificate Program in Data Science provides a thorough introduction to essential data science concepts and techniques. The program covers topics such as data collection, cleaning, preprocessing and exploratory data analysis. Students will gain hands-on experience with Python and popular libraries like Pandas and NumPy, along with foundational knowledge in statistics and machine learning. The course explores both supervised and unsupervised learning techniques, model evaluation and performance metrics. The final project allows students to apply their skills to a real-world dataset, ensuring they are well-prepared for career opportunities or further studies in data science.

Certificate Program in

Python

The Certificate Program in Python with a structured, 12-module course aimed at individuals new to programming who wish to build a strong foundation in Python. Covering essential Python concepts and practical applications, this course prepares participants to write, manage, and debug Python code effectively. Each module focuses on a key area, from basic syntax and data handling to more advanced topics like object-oriented programming, error management, and file handling.

Certificate Program in

API Test Automation

The Certificate Program in API Test Automation is crafted for beginners looking to gain hands-on skills in API testing and automation. This program covers the essentials of API (Application Programming Interface) testing, focusing on the role APIs play in software applications and how automated testing can ensure their functionality, reliability and security.

Certificate Program in

Back-End Web Development

This Certificate Program in Back-End Development is designed for individuals from non-IT backgrounds who wish to build a strong foundation in back-end web development. The course covers essential programming concepts, server-side technologies, databases and API integration, enabling participants to create robust and scalable back-end systems. With hands-on projects and real-world examples, students will acquire the skills needed to kickstart a career in back-end web development.

Certificate Program in

Front-End Web Development

The Certificate Program in Front-End Development introduces students to the essentials of front-end web development through a structured and hands-on approach. It covers HTML for structuring content, CSS for styling and layout and JavaScript for interactive features. The program also provides insight into responsive design principles to ensure that websites work seamlessly on different devices. No prior coding experience is required, making this course suitable for complete beginners.

Certificate Program in

Performance Testing Using jMeter

The Certificate Program in Performance Testing using JMeter is designed for individuals from non-IT backgrounds who wish to gain expertise in testing the performance, scalability and reliability of web applications. This program provides a practical introduction to performance testing concepts and equips participants with hands-on experience using Apache JMeter, one of the most popular performance testing tools. By the end of the program, participants will have the confidence to plan, execute and analyze performance tests to ensure robust software performance.

Certificate Program in

Software Testing

The Certificate Program in Software Testing is designed to introduce the foundational concepts of software testing to individuals with basic computer knowledge. This course focuses on manual testing techniques, testing terminology, methodologies and best practices that will allow learners to understand the importance of quality assurance in software development. Students will learn how to identify defects, write test cases and perform testing processes manually without involving automated tools.

Certificate Program in

Digital Marketing

The Certificate Program in Digital Marketing is designed to introduce non-IT graduates to the essential tools, techniques and strategies used in online marketing. This beginner-friendly program focuses on equipping students with practical skills to create and manage successful digital campaigns, helping businesses grow in a highly competitive digital landscape. With a mix of theoretical concepts and hands-on projects, participants will gain confidence and expertise to excel in this dynamic field.

Certificate Program in

Java

The Certificate Program in Java is a foundational course designed for individuals with basic computer knowledge who want to learn programming from scratch. This program covers essential Java programming skills, including syntax, control structures, data handling, and object-oriented programming (OOP). By completing this course, students will gain hands-on experience in Java, preparing them to pursue further studies in software development or entry-level programming roles.

Certificate Program in

Machine Learning

This Certificate Program in Machine Learning is designed to introduce individuals with minimal technical experience to the exciting field of machine learning (ML). Covering fundamental concepts and practical skills, this program enables students to understand and apply ML basics. Each module is carefully designed to progressively build knowledge and introduce tools used by data scientists and machine learning practitioners.

Certificate Program in

UI Test Automation

This beginner-friendly Certificate Program in UI Test Automation introduces participants to UI Test Automation, focusing on basic principles and tools to automate the testing of user interfaces. It equips learners with the skills needed to understand and implement automated testing techniques in modern web applications. The program emphasizes hands-on practice with accessible automation tools, suitable for those with very basic computer knowledge.

Certificate Program in

UI/UX Design

This Certificate Program in UI/UX Design introduces learners to the principles and practices of user interface (UI) and user experience (UX) design. With a focus on practical skills and foundational knowledge, this program guides students through the process of creating intuitive, user-centered digital interfaces. Students will gain hands-on experience using basic design tools, understanding the fundamentals of human-centered design and applying UX methodologies to enhance user satisfaction.

Certificate Program in

Digital Literacy

Microsoft Office Applications, Online Communication, Social Media Management, and Cybersecurity

The Certificate Program in Digital Literacy: Microsoft Office Applications, Online Communication, Social Media Management, and Cybersecurity is designed to equip learners with essential digital skills required in today’s fast-paced and technology-driven work environments. This comprehensive course covers the fundamental tools and practices that are vital for professional success and online safety.

Certificate Program in

Python Programming for Kids

The Certificate Program in Python Programming for Kids is an engaging and practical course designed to introduce children aged 10-17 to the exciting world of coding. This program focuses on building foundational Python programming skills while fostering creativity, problem-solving, and critical thinking. Through hands-on projects and interactive lessons, students will gain real-world coding experience and develop skills that will prepare them for a future in the IT field.

Certificate Program in

Digital Transformation for Account Management

The Certificate in Digital Transformation for Account Management equips accounting professionals with skills to adopt modern, automated, and data-driven practices. It blends technology with traditional accounting to improve efficiency, accuracy, and compliance. Participants gain hands-on experience with advanced accounting software, automation tools, and digital workflows to thrive in today’s dynamic business environment.

Certificate Program in

Digital Transformation for Human Resource Management

The Certificate in Digital Transformation for Human Resource Management is a 48-hour program for non-technical HR professionals to harness digital tools, AI, and automation. It covers digital HR trends like data analytics, chatbots, and AI-driven decision-making to enhance efficiency and employee engagement. Through hands-on workshops and case studies, participants gain the skills to lead digital transformation in their organizations.

English for Information

Technology

The English for Information Technology course is designed to provide learners with essential English language skills tailored for the field of Information Technology (IT). Aimed at very junior learners with basic computer knowledge, the course focuses on developing vocabulary, comprehension and communication skills relevant to common IT contexts. By the end, participants will feel more confident in using English to describe, navigate and work within basic IT environments, preparing them for further technical studies or entry-level roles in the tech industry.

English for Information

Technology Professionals

The English for Information Technology Professionals program is designed to improve English language proficiency specifically for Information Technology (IT) professionals. With a practical, skills-based approach, participants will learn the language of IT, including technical terms, business communication and effective teamwork strategies. Each module is tailored to different aspects of IT work, enabling learners to confidently communicate in various professional scenarios.

General Information Technology (GIT) and Digital Innovation for Tomorrow (DIT) for Grade 12

This course introduces Grade 12 students to essential IT skills, including computing, data management, and cybersecurity, while exploring emerging technologies like AI, blockchain, and cloud computing. It fosters technical expertise and innovation, preparing students for future academic and career opportunities in the digital world.

How to Apply

Tell us a little about yourself and we’ll help with the rest. Our convenient online application tool only takes 10 minutes to complete.

After you submit your application, an admissions representative will contact you and will help you to complete the process.

Once you’ve completed your application and connected with an admissions representative, you’re ready to create your schedule.

How To Apply

Your Application

Tell us a little about yourself and we’ll help with the rest. Our convenient online application tool only takes 10 minutes to complete.

Our Response

After you submit your application, an admissions representative will contact you and will help you to complete the process.

Your Journey

Once you’ve completed your application and connected with an admissions representative, you’re ready to create your schedule.

FORM

Are you ready to take the next step toward your future career?